Alkali metal phosphides are useful intermediates for the synthesis of a variety of phosphine derivatives. Many of these phosphine derivatives are important industrial compounds with applications as synthetic intermediates or as ligands in a variety of homogeneous and heterogeneous synthetic processes. Alkali metal diarylphosphides in particular have been used in the synthesis of many phosphine ligands of importance. The invention relates to methods for generating and using alkali metal phosphides by reduction of the phosphorus sigma bonds of tri-substituted phosphorus derivatives with Group I metal/porous oxide compositions.
